Arsenal fans react as Newcastle reportedly eye Matteo Guendouzi
Matteo Guendouzi has emerged as a reported target for Newcastle as he remains on loan from Arsenal at Marseille – and Arsenal fans have reacted.
Newcastle’s new owners are keen to bring some new players to the club – as they embark on a new era. Eddie Howe is close to joining as manager.
Howe is believed to be signing a three-year deal at Newcastle, after talks to bring in Unai Emery failed. He publicly rejected a move to Tyneside.
Attention will soon turn to players, and reports from France claim an Arsenal-owned midfielder is on their radar – namely, Guendouzi.
Guendouzi, 22, has been loaned out twice by Arsenal – to Hertha Berlin and now Marseille. A permanent clause of £9.5million has been included.

Newcastle do need options in the middle of the park. Jonjo Shelvey, Isaac Hayden, Sean Longstaff and Joe Willock are the current options.
Before Steve Bruce left, he wanted a central midfielder and a centre-back but never got his wish. The need for a midfielder remains.
Guendouzi would give Newcastle not only another option in midfield, but a much-improved option, too. He is still young, and a bargain at £9.5million.
